Special Program at the Equinunk Historical Society on November 6

Posted

EQUINUNK, PA - The Equinunk Historical Society will gratefully honor veteran Everett Hawley in a program on Saturday, November 6, at 1 p.m.

This program was originally scheduled to take place on Memorial Day weekend, but was postponed because of the pandemic. Appropriately, with Veterans’ Day imminent, EHS is pleased to be able to honor Everett who was a member of the National Guard in the 1950’s. Traveling with his unit for training prior to deployment to Korea, on Sept. 11, 1950 a fast Pennsylvania Railroad passenger train ploughed into the rear of the standing troop train in Ohio, during a heavy fog. Thirty-three young men lost their lives in the wreck. (Excerpted from Ohio State Highway Patrol records.) Mr. Hawley will be traveling from his home in the south to be with attendees.
